9 ACT ONE SCENE II It is in the early hours of the afternoon. Charity is alone in Peter's apartment. She is knitting and singing songs of faith. CHARITY [Singing as she knits] Yes, I believe; Yes, I believe; Yes, I believe; Jesus died for me. Open, open, open are the gates of Heaven. Open, open, open is the heart of Jesus. Let's flood in one and all; let's flood in and be saved by the spilt blood of the sacred Lamb. [There is a knock at the door. Charity interrupts her singing and knitting, and goes to answer it. In comes Damien] DAMIEN Good afternoon Charity. CHARITY Good afternoon brother. DAMIEN [Smiling] You always mistake me for your brother. Do I resemble Peter that much? CHARITY No, but you are my brother in Christ. Whereas Peter is only a biological brother. 10 DAMIEN But who is more a brother? CHARITY The one in Christ, of course; which is why I wish you were one such brother to me. DAMIEN Has Peter gone back to work already? CHARITY Yes.... To what denomination do you belong? DAMIEN Catholic. CHARITY No doubt. I can smell a catholic from a thousand miles [smiles]. When will you receive Christ, Damien? Tell me in earnest. It isn't too late yet; you can still be saved. But you must hurry. When will you be born again in the Lord? Please, say when, for time is fast running out. DAMIEN What do you mean? [smiling] Don’t you know that I'm baptised? Where do you think I got the name Damien from? CHARITY No, what I mean is to be truly born again.
